Grupo Televisa, S.A.B. (NYSE:TV) Lifted to Buy at StockNews.com

StockNews.com upgraded shares of Grupo Televisa, S.A.B. (NYSE:TVFree Report) from a hold rating to a buy rating in a research report released on Wednesday.

Several other research firms also recently commented on TV. The Goldman Sachs Group dropped their target price on Grupo Televisa, S.A.B. from $3.30 to $2.90 and set a buy rating for the company in a research report on Monday, August 5th. Benchmark reiterated a buy rating and issued a $12.00 target price on shares of Grupo Televisa, S.A.B. in a research report on Thursday, May 16th. Four equities research analysts have rated the stock with a hold rating and three have given a buy rating to the stock. According to MarketBeat.com, the company has a consensus rating of Hold and a consensus price target of $5.16.

Grupo Televisa, S.A.B. Price Performance

Shares of TV stock opened at $1.86 on Wednesday. The company has a quick ratio of 2.28, a current ratio of 2.31 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.04. Grupo Televisa, S.A.B. has a twelve month low of $1.69 and a twelve month high of $3.65. The company has a market cap of $1.03 billion, a P/E ratio of -2.14, a P/E/G ratio of 0.86 and a beta of 1.88. The business has a fifty day simple moving average of $2.13 and a 200 day simple moving average of $2.71.

Grupo Televisa, S.A.B. Company Profile

Grupo Televisa, SAB., together with its subsidiaries, owns and operates cable companies and provides direct-to-home satellite pay television system in Mexico and the United States. It operates through three segments: Cable, Sky, and Other Businesses. The Cable segment operates cable multiple system that provides basic and premium television subscription, pay-per-view, installation, Internet subscription, and telephone and mobile services subscription, as well as local and national advertising services; and telecommunication facilities, which offers data and long-distance services solutions to carriers and other telecommunications service providers through its fiber-optic network.
